What Is Crypto Market Cap?

Market cap is the total value of a cryptocurrency. You calculate it by multiplying the current price of one coin by how many coins are in circulation. This gives you a way to compare the relative size of different cryptocurrencies, similar to how market cap works for stocks.

For example, if a cryptocurrency trades at $50,000 per coin and has 20 million coins in circulation, its market cap would be $1 trillion.

The total crypto market cap adds up all cryptocurrencies together. This number changes constantly as prices move and new tokens enter the market.

How Market Capitalization Works in Cryptocurrency

Two things determine market cap: price and circulating supply. Price comes from recent trading against currencies like the US dollar. Circulating supply is the number of coins actually available to trade.

Projects sometimes report other supply numbers. Total supply includes all coins that will ever exist, including locked tokens. Maximum supply is the hard cap on how many coins can exist. A cryptocurrency with a large supply trading at a low price might have a similar market cap to one with limited supply trading at a higher price.

Market cap changes happen because prices move, supply adjusts through token burns or unlocks, and new tokens get created through mining or staking.

Factors Influencing Crypto Market Cap

Several factors drive market cap changes. Supply and demand matter most. Some cryptocurrencies have capped supplies, like Bitcoin’s 21 million coin limit. Others have inflationary models. These differences affect how investors think about long-term value.

Regulatory news has a huge impact. Government announcements about regulation, taxes, or bans can cause rapid market moves. When institutions adopt cryptocurrencies, valuations tend to rise.

Technology changes also matter. Protocol upgrades, hard forks, and new features can attract or repel investors based on their view of the project’s technical direction.

Macroeconomic conditions affect crypto markets too. During economic uncertainty, some people buy crypto as a hedge while others move to traditional safe havens. Interest rates, inflation, and geopolitical events all ripple through crypto markets.

Market Cap Categories and Investment Implications

Cryptocurrencies fall into different market cap categories, each with different risk and reward profiles.

Large-cap cryptocurrencies (above $10 billion) usually offer more stability but less growth potential. They have established user bases, higher liquidity, and more market infrastructure.

Mid-cap cryptocurrencies ($1 billion to $10 billion) sit in the middle. They often have higher growth potential than large-cap assets while keeping some stability advantages.

Small-cap and micro-cap cryptocurrencies (below $1 billion) are the riskiest. Many projects fail or underperform. Some successful projects started small, but identifying these opportunities requires extensive research and tolerance for potential total loss.

Market cap helps inform decisions but shouldn’t be the only factor. A high market cap shows established adoption. A low market cap might mean untapped potential or fundamental problems.

The Significance of Market Cap for Portfolio Management

Investors use market cap to build diversified portfolios. Many advisors recommend mixing large-cap stability assets with smaller allocations to mid-cap and small-cap opportunities.

Rebalancing based on market cap changes keeps your portfolio aligned with your target allocations. When assets appreciate significantly, their weight may exceed your targets, requiring rebalancing to manage risk.

Market cap benchmarks let you compare performance. Tracking how your portfolio does against total crypto market cap movements shows whether you’re outperforming or underperforming the broader market.

Can crypto market cap be manipulated?

It’s harder than in traditional markets, but crypto market cap can be influenced through trading, especially in less liquid assets. Thin order books on smaller exchanges can amplify price movements.
